You are on page 1of 7

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ology

ISSN No:-2456-2165

Channel Estimation of ZF and MMSE


in MIMO System
Roji Y.1; Shiva Prasad Avutha2; Arun Dakoori3; Binith Dandu4
Assistant Professor 1, Students2,3,4
Electronics and communication Engineering,
Vignana Bharathi Institute of Technology, Telangana, India

Abstract:- Enhancing communication efficiency and computational complexity compared to ZF, it provides
dependability in multiple input/multiple output systems superior accuracy and reliability.
(MIMO) is largely dependent on channel estimation.
Two popular methods for calculating mean square error The employment of these channel estimation
(MMSE) and zero forcing (ZF) are obtaining precise techniques significantly enhances the performance of MIMO
channel estimation. By creating an inverted channel systems, leading to improved data rates and overall system
matrix, the Zero Forcing method seeks to neutralize efficiency. The selection between ZF and MMSE depends
interference and essentially eliminate the influence of on specific application requirements, computational
inter-symbol interference. Though it may be susceptible considerations, and the prevailing conditions of the
to errors and noise, this approach is computationally communication channel.
efficient. On the other hand, the aim of lowest mean
square error channel estimating is to minimize the mean II. LITERATURE SURVEY
square error between the estimated and actual channels. There have been studies about MIMO systems' channel
keeping in mind both noise and interference. This estimation published in the literature, these studies have
technique provides improved robustness compared to primarily focused on the use of the techniques for minimum
ZF, especially in challenging signal conditions. Both ZF mean square error (MMSE) and zero forcing
and MMSE techniques contribute significantly to the (ZF).Researchers have looked into a number of these
advancements of MIMO systems, with each method strategies' facets in an effort to boost MIMO communication
presenting its own advantages and trade-offs. The choice systems' efficiency.
of channel estimation method depends on specific
 Zero Forcing (ZF) Channel Estimation: ZF aims to
application requirements, computational complexity eliminate interference between different antennas,
considerations, and the prevailing signal environment. simplifying channel estimation in MIMO systems, as
Accurate channel estimates are crucial for optimizing suggested by the literature. Studies highlight ZF's
data rates and ensuring reliable communication
capability to handle spatial interference but acknowledge
in MIMO Systems.
challenges in scenarios with high signal-to-noise ratio
Keywords:- Bit error rate (BER), Rayleigh Channels, Zero (SNR) due to noise amplification. MMSE stands for
Forcing (ZF), Multiple Input Multiple Output Systems Minimum Mean Square Error. Both signal and noise
(MIMO), Signal to Noise Ratio (SNR), Binary Phase Shift statistics are taken into consideration by MMSE when
Keying (BPSK), and Minimum Mean Square Error Method estimating the channel.
(MMSE).
The literature emphasizes the significance of prior
I. INTRODUCTION knowledge of channel statistics for accurate MMSE
channel estimation.
Regarding networks of communications using multiple
input multiple output (MIMO), effective data transmission  Comparative Analysis: Several comparative studies
requires precise channel estimation. Specifically, Zero investigate the trade-offs between ZF and MMSE
Forcing (ZF) and Minimum Mean Square Error (MMSE) are channel estimation techniques.
two frequently utilized methods for channel estimation in
Metrics of performance like bit error rate (BER),
MIMO systems. Removing interference through the creation
spectral efficiency, and system capacity are commonly
of an inverse channel matrix is the main goal of Zero
employed to evaluate and compare these methods.
Forcing channel estimation.By nullifying inter-symbol
interference, ZF enhances the system's resilience. However,  Adaptive Techniques: Attention has been given to
due to its simplistic approach, ZF may be vulnerable to adaptive channel estimation techniques, where the
noise and inaccuracies. estimation strategy adapts to the changing channel
characteristics.
In contrast, The Minimum Mean Square Error channel
estimating method lowers the estimated and actual channels' Adaptive algorithms aim to strike a balance
mean square error method adopts a more thorough between the simplicity of ZF and the optimality of
approach.It takes into account both noise and interference, MMSE in varying channel conditions.
thus offering better performance in challenging signal
environments. Although MMSE entails higher

IJISRT23NOV796 www.ijisrt.com 829


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
 Spatial Correlation: The effects of Antenna spatial performance, the accuracy of channel estimation is essential.
correlation during channel estimation performance and Let's examine channel estimation in MIMO systems in more
computational complexity are extensively studied in detail. The channel estimation process can be broken down
literature. In practical MIMO scenarios, spatial into several steps. Firstly, a mathematical model of the
correlation effects are important and can affect the channel is constructed. Then, a known signal is sent through
decision between ZF and MMSE. the channel, which can be identified by both the sender and
the receiver.The receiver not only receives noise and
 Machine Learning Approaches: Emerging trends focus distortions from the channel upon receiving the signal, but it
on incorporating machine learning techniques to enhance also knows the original signal. Therefore, the characteristics
channel estimation in MIMO systems. of the channel and the noise added during transmission can
be extracted by comparing the original signal with the
Deep learning models, such as neural networks, received signal.
show promise in improving the accuracy of channel
estimates. We have chosen the top three channels to discuss in
this paper.
 Practical Implementations and Challenges: Real-
world implementations of ZF and MMSEchannel The AWGN Channel (Additivity in White Gaussian
estimation in MIMO systems are discussed, addressing Noise): The channel model for AWGN isextended to include
challenges related to hardware constraints and multiple antennas at the transmitting and receiving ends to
computational complexity. make the concept of a MIMO system a reality. Gaussian
noise is uniformly distributed and independent of each
III. SIGNAL DETECTION OF ZF AND MMSE-MIMO receiving antenna. Within MIMO, the AWGN channel is
defined by a N x M noise matrix, where N is the number of
Several Input Multiple Output (MIMO) wireless antennas that are receiving and M is the number that are
communication technology employs several antennas at the transmitting.The signal that passes through this channel is
transmitting (Tx) and receiving (Rx) points to enhance the filtered through with white Gaussian noise. Its amplitude
performance of a communication link receiving (Rx) ends. frequency response is therefore uniformly flat,enabling
By capitalizing on spatial diversity and multipath modulated signals to traverse without any loss of amplitude
propagation, MIMO technology contributes significantly to or distortion of phase in terms of frequency elements. By
the overall improvement of wireless communicationsystems. avoiding fading, the AWGN channel solely introduces
It serves as a fundamental facilitator in achievinghigher data distortion through the Gaussian noise additive white noise.
rates, enhanced reliability, and improved spectral efficiency Thus, the received signal can be made simpler as:
in modern wireless networks.
x(t) + n(t) = r(t)
To enhance the effectiveness of a communication
link, a wireless communication technology called Multiple S where the additive white Gaussian noise is denoted by
everal Inputs and Outputs (MI) Multiple output is referred to n(t)symbol. A fixed random function possessing a level
as MIMO. a wireless communication method that makes power spectral density (PSD) at all frequencies is referred to
advantage of multiple antennas at the transmitting (Tx) and as "whiteness" of n(t). It is conventionally assumed that the
receiving (Rx) ends to improve the performance of a PSD of n(t) is equal to N0/2, where -∞ < f. As a widely
communication link.Through spatial multiplexing, MIMO utilized and straightforward channel model, the AWGN
systems can achieve higher data rates without the need for channel effectively captures the impact of noise in a
additional bandwidth. As the number of antenna pairs communication system. It assumes that the primary form of
increases at both ends, the potential data rate is distortion is as supplementary Gaussian noise, characterized
correspondingly augmented. by a constant power spectral density and a normal
distribution with a zero mean.
MIMO technology finds extensive application across
various wireless communication standards, including Wi-Fi, V. RAYLEIGH CHANNEL
4G LTE, and 5G. It plays an integral role in enhancing the
spectral efficiency and reliability of wireless networks. The results of multiple paths, which include both
beneficial and detrimental interference as well as signal
IV. CHANNEL ESTIMATION phase shifting, result in the phenomenon known as Rayleigh
fading. A Channel of Rayleigh fading has not in a direct line
The process of channel estimation holds great of sight(NLOS) path, meaning that The transmitter and
importance in wireless communication systems as it receiver are not connected directly. For this channel, the
involves determining the characteristics of the transmission received signal can be summed up as
channel used for sending signals from the transmitter to the
receiver.When it comes to Understanding the features the R(n)W(n) + S(n-m) = h(n-τ)
transmitter and receiver are connected via a wireless
channel. crucial for Communication systems estimation where w(n), or additive white Gaussian noise (AWGN)
using MIMO (Multiple Input Multiple Output). To the extent with zero mean and unit variance, and h(n), or channel
that applying different MIMO techniques, guaranteeing the impulse response, are expressed. In this case, the nth path's
dependability of data transmission, and maximizing system

IJISRT23NOV796 www.ijisrt.com 830


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
phase shift and attenuation are represented by (n) and (-), multiplexing, these systems use numerous antennas on the
respectively. receiver and transmitter ends. Zero-forcing aims to improve
the quality of signals received by reducing or eliminating
The channel's coherence bandwidth in relation to the interfering signals. One way to achieve this is by employing
signal bandwidth determines the fading channel's an equalizer that combines channel samples and impulse
classification. The channel is referred to as a flat fading responses. However, it should be noted that when the
channel if the coherence bandwidth is larger. Notit is coefficients become too large, receivers implementing such
referred to as a channel that selectively fades frequencies. In equalizers may experience issues. Filters that assume null
the presence of a frequency-selective fading channel, this Inter-Symbol Interference (ISI) over the entire bandwidth or
study addresses the modeling of OFDM stands for only a portion of it can offer high attenuation and increased
orthogonal frequency division multiplexing.for multi-input noise suppression. Zero-forcing is also known as null-
multi-output systems (MIMO). The distribution of Rayleigh, steering, as it allows multiple antenna transmitters to nullify
which is the magnitude of the product of two equal multiuser interference. By utilizing linear equalization
independent Gaussian random variables that are orthogonal, techniques, zero-forcing aims to eliminate interference by
characterizes the fading phenomenon. constructing an equalizer matrix that counteracts the effects
of interference between different antennas. This is
VI. THE RICIAN CHANNEL accomplished by estimating between every transmit-receive
The complex Gaussian fading coefficient is connected antenna pair, the channel response using channel state
to the transmitter and receiver through the dominant path. information (CSI).Based on this information, an inverse
Rician distribution should have a non-zero mean. with clear equalizer matrix is created. When this matrix is multiplied
visibility (LOS). Alternatively, it can be said that Rayleigh with the received signal vector, it cancels out any
fading, which is also known as Rician fading, has features of interference caused by other transmit antennas. The name
a Rician distribution when it is accompanied by a strong line "zero forcing" is derived from the fact that this equalization
of sight (LOS) component. The Rice factor, technique forces the output of the equalizer to be zero for all
interfering symbols, effectively eliminating inter-
K=m/ 2 σ 2 antennainterference and enhancing overall system
performance.
The Rician distribution is commonly characterized by
(abbreviated κ), which represents the direct LOS path's The following are mathematical expressions for
relative strength in the fading coefficientWhen κ is large, subchannels in the MIMO OFDM system
this model reduces to Rayleigh fading. equals zero.
K + N(K) + H(K).X(K) = R(K)
VII. SIGNAL DETECTION OF MIMO SYSTEM

A. Zero Forcing Equalizer(Zf):


Multiple output and multiple input are used in
communication systems. (MIMO), zero-forcing is a popular
signal processing technique. In order to improve wireless
communication performance through spatial diversity and

Fig. 1: Flow of ZF

IJISRT23NOV796 www.ijisrt.com 831


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
The ZF equalization can be mathematically represented accounting for channel noise and interference, it plays a
as significant role in channel estimation and equalization. H
XZF=H-IR (Nr x Nt) is a MIMO system's channel matrix that uses Nr
for reception and Nt for transmission antennas.The channel
Where X is estimated transmitted signal vector gain from transmit antenna j to receive antenna iis
H^(-1) is inverse within the MIMO channel. Matrix represented by each element h(i,j) in the matrix. For
R is received signal vector at the receiver additional illustration, consider the following.y is the signal
vector that was received. (Nr x 1n is the vector of additive
B. MMSE Equalizer: white Gaussian noise (AWGN) samples at the receiving
A key method when using multiple inputs and multiple end.The vector of transmitted symbols is represented by x.
outputs (MIMO) communication the Minimal Squared Error (Nt x 1).
(MMSE) in systems. By trying to lessen the meansquare
error between the signals that are sent and received while

Fig. 2: Flow chart of MMSE

VIII. STEPS FOR SIMULATION OF ZF AND MMSE

Fig. 3: Flow chart of ZF and MMSE

IJISRT23NOV796 www.ijisrt.com 832


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
IX. PERFORMANCE EVALUATION METRICS X. THE SIGNAL TO NOISE RATIO (SNR)

A. Rate of Bit Errors (BER): Ratio of signal to noise (SNR)serves as a crucial metric
When assessing the efficacy of digital communication for evaluating signal quality while facing background noise
systems, bit error rate (BER) is an essential metric. This is or interference. It measures the distinction between the
especially true when transferring data over wired or wireless desired signal and any unwanted or superfluous signals,
communication links. In comparison to the total number of commonly referred to as noise. SNR is often expressed as a
bits transmitted or received within a given timeframe, it ratio or in decibels (dB) and finds applications in various
calculates the percentage of incorrect bits received. Most fields, such as telecommunications, electronics, audio
frequently, BER is shown as a percentage or in exponential engineering, and image processing.
notation.
The calculation of SNR in linear form can be
The following formula can be used to calculate the represented by the following formula:
Number of Bit Errors.
SNR = Signal Power / Noise Power
(Number of Bit Errors) / (Total Bits Transmitted) is
how BER is computed. For decibel (dB) representation, SNR is typically
calculated as:
 Number of Bit Errors: This refers to the tally of
incorrectly received or corrupted bits during SNR(dB) is equal to 10 * log10(noise power / signal
transmission. Bit errors can arise from a multitude of power).
factors, including noise, interference, distortion, and
channel impairments.  Power of Signal: This corresponds to the strength or
 Total Bits Transmitted: This refers to the total number power of the desired signal, indicating its prominence
of bits—both accurate and inaccurate—that are sent or amid the presence of noise.
received over the course of a given time period.  Noise Power: This represents the power of undesired or
interfering signals, encompassing background noise,
By providing an insight into the system's performance, electrical disturbances, or any extraneous signals that
the resulting BER value proves instrumental: undermine signal quality.

A lower BER signifies a higher quality and more SNR is commonly expressed in dB due to its
dependable communication system, as a smaller number of convenience in representing a wide range of values. In dB, a
bits are received erroneously. higher SNR signifies superior signal quality, as it indicates
that the signal power significantly exceeds the noise power.
A higher BER implies that the communication link
may be beset by more errors and is thus less reliable.
BER measurements play a pivotal role in
communication system design, testing, and optimization.
They empower engineers to evaluate system performance
across diverse conditions and make necessary adjustments to
enhance reliability. To ascertain BER, specialized test
equipment is often utilized to generate predetermined bit
patterns, transmit them through the system under
examination, and subsequently compare the received bits
with the expected bits.

IJISRT23NOV796 www.ijisrt.com 833


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
XI. PROPOSED ALGORITHM

Start

Generation of random binary sequence

BPSK Modulation i.e. bit 0 represented as-1 and bit 1 represented as + 1 bit 1 representedas +1

Application of ZF and MMSE Detector

Adding White Gaussian Noise

Computing the MMSE,Z Fequalization filter at the receiver the receiver

Demodulation and conversion to bits

Counting the number of bit errors

Repeating for multiple values of Eb/No

Stop
Fig. 4: Proposed Algorithm

XII. SIMULATION RESULT

Fig. 5: Simulation Result

IJISRT23NOV796 www.ijisrt.com 834


Volume 8, Issue 11, November 2023 International Journal of Innovative Science and Research Technology
ISSN No:-2456-2165
XIII. CONCLUSION

Equalization techniques are essential for effectively


combating inter-symbol interference (ISI) in mobile fading
channels. The efficiency of the Zero Forcing equalizer
dramatically decreases in mobile fading environments, even
though it might perform better in ideal scenarios with zero
noise. In contrast, the Least Mean Squares (LMS) algorithm
is used by the Equalizer for Minimum Mean Square Error
(MMSE) to take ISI into consideration. The MMSE
equalizer exhibits an approximately 3dB improvement over
the Zero Forcing equalizer. Furthermore, the Bit Error Rate
(BER) is improved by about 2.2dB when ZF-SIC stands for
Zero Forcing Equalization with Successive Interference
Cancellation. procedure is used. Additionally, compared to
standard ZF-SIC, adopting the optimal ordering in ZF-SIC
leads to a BER improvement of about 2dB.

REFERENCES

[1]. S. Nagarani, C. V. Seshiah, 2011. “An Efficient Space-


Time Coding for Wireless Communication”. European
Journal of Scientific Research Vol.52 No.2 pp.195-203.
[2]. V. Tarokh, A. Naguibandetal. 1999 “Space time codes
for high data rate Wireless communication:
performance criteria in the presence of channel
estimation errors, mobility, and Multiple paths,”
[3]. S. M. Alamouti,1998 “A simple transmit diversity
technique for wireless communications,” IEEE Journal
on Selected Areas in Communications, vol. 16, no. 8,
pp. 1451-1458.
[4]. H. Zhang, H. Dai, Q. Zhou, and B. L. Hughes, 2006
On the diversity-multiplexing tradeo for ordered SIC
receivers over MIMO channels, "IEEE International
Conference on Communications (ICC), Istanbul,
Turkey.
[5]. S. Haykin, K. Huber, and Z. Chen, “Bayesian
Sequential State Estimation for MIMO Wireless
Communications,” IEEE. Procedings,Vol. 92. No. 3,
pp. 439-454, Mar. 2004
[6]. Approximate Minimum BER Power Allocation for
MIMO Spatial Multiplexing Systems Neng Wang and
Steven D. Blostein, Senior Member, IEEE.
[7]. I. E. Telatar, “Capacity of multi-antenna Gaussian
channels, «E u r.Trans. Telecom m UN. vol. 10, pp.
585-595, Nov. 1999.
[8]. B. M. Hochwald and T. L. Marzetta, “Unitary space-
time modulation for multiple-antenna communication
in Rayleigh flat fading,” IEEE Trans. Inform. Theory ,
vol. 46, pp 543-564, Mar. 2000.

IJISRT23NOV796 www.ijisrt.com 835

You might also like